Stein und Bein is an intriguing drama that really captures the essence of human struggle and resilience. The pacing is deliberate, allowing the audience to steep in the character's emotional turmoil, which is both haunting and raw. The atmosphere is thick with a sense of unease, enhanced by the practical effects that ground the narrative in a gritty reality. Performances here are quite compelling, with actors who embrace their roles fully, creating a tangible connection to their plights. It’s a film that doesn’t shy away from uncomfortable truths, and the themes of loss and perseverance linger long after the credits roll. Definitely a unique piece that stands out for its authenticity.
